Where a handicap was an estimate for a new or lapsed runner they only score one point but their handicap for next month will be based on this time and qualify for a full score. A season's best earns two bonus points. Please check your statistics on both tables and notify me of any errors.
Congratulations to Dave Cosh on winning the Handicap Plate for 2007-8. Dave started the last race a single point ahead of Dave Wood but as neither improved their score he takes the trophy by the narrowest of margins, 225 points to 224.
In winning her second race Sue O'Callaghan improved by over 2 minutes and brand new member Chris Groves recorded a very creditable 23.10 on his first outing. Other notable runs were those of Mel and Julia who also ran pbs.
